EZChoice aims to become the biggest insurance comparison website in Vietnam

HANOI, VIETNAM - Media OutReach - 17 October 2022 - Since the COVID-19 pandemic, many people have been searching for health insurance packages and long-term financial strategies that can safeguard them against unpredictable risks.

Such increasing demand is seen as a sizable playground for startups in the InsurTech industry (Insurance Technology) to prove their value. EZChoice is a strong player in this field.


Customers can compare and select insurance products in just a few clicks

EZChoice insurance aggregator platform is carrying out the mission to become Vietnam's biggest website to compare financial products, providing customers with comprehensive information on prices, promotions, and benefits from several companies. With an intuitive and easy-to-use interface, the website enables users to make a purchase in just a few clicks.

EZChoice aggregates a wide range of insurance packages including health insurance, total car insurance, car liability insurance, and motorbike insurance from Vietnam's top insurance companies such as Bao Viet, PVI, PTI, Bao Minh, Vietinbank (VBI), MIC, and BSH. These packages allow users to compare multiple insurance packages side by side without waiting for customer service, shortening the distance between the buyers and the product. The types of products are neatly grouped into tabs that lead users to fill in a quick form with some details of their insurance needs. Then, a range of options will be presented for quick evaluation.
